Transaction 76853390e2b73a1852df139182712d1ddd6ed9f3cf72ad60975c036e77efd42f
1 Input
1 Output
-
76853390e2b73a1852df139182712d1ddd6ed9f3cf72ad60975c036e77efd42f:0
- value
- 27779
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c70166beef795ba2e12a5032195dcbbb910d938
- address
- bc1qf3cpv6lw772m5tsj55pjr9wuhwu3pkfcnyzuqp